Job Role Description
Online Dating App Governance Officer (Primary: Governance, Secondary: Compliance) Develops and implements data privacy and security policies, ensuring compliance with UK regulations. Manages risk and ensures ethical online dating practices.
Data Protection Specialist (Online Dating) (Primary: Data Protection, Secondary: Privacy) Focuses on the protection of user data, handling data breaches, and implementing data minimization strategies within the online dating app. Ensures GDPR and UK data protection laws are adhered to.
Cybersecurity Analyst (Online Dating Platform) (Primary: Cybersecurity, Secondary: Threat Intelligence) Identifies and mitigates cybersecurity risks, protects user accounts and data from malicious attacks, and ensures the platform's overall security. Experience in threat intelligence a plus.
Compliance Manager (Online Dating App) (Primary: Compliance, Secondary: Legal) Ensures the app's adherence to all relevant UK laws and regulations, including advertising standards, data protection, and content moderation policies. Acts as a point of contact for legal matters.
Content Moderator (Online Dating App) (Primary: Moderation, Secondary: Safety) Reviews and manages user-generated content to ensure safety and compliance with community guidelines, preventing harmful or inappropriate content from appearing on the platform.
